Transaction 98351d9185829e1ebd31765f125f7f446e7278914e4afb91662390e7d54f4821
1 Input
1 Output
-
98351d9185829e1ebd31765f125f7f446e7278914e4afb91662390e7d54f4821:0
- value
- 2384940
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 37bb8420dd0ead7403859db420cb38d528823c25 OP_EQUALVERIFY OP_CHECKSIG
- address
- 165goQB65U75aCn24rhdU1dAjEA4SGZqee